Etymology

From Ottoman Turkish بوستانجی (bostancı), from بوستان (bostân, market garden) (from Persian بوستان (bôstân)), and جی (-ci, maker, dealer).[1]

Noun

bostanji (plural bostanjis)

  1. One of the imperial guards of the Ottoman Empire.
